When calculating returns in retail, understanding how discounts and refunds add up can be helpful for both customers and business owners. One common scenario is when each store returns 15% of a $200 product—resulting in a precise $30 refund. But what does this really mean, and why does it matter?
The Math Behind the Return: 15% of $200 = $30
Understanding the Context
To break it down simply:
When a product costs $200 and the store offers a 15% return credit, the refund amount is calculated as:
15% × $200 = 0.15 × 200 = $30
This means every customer returning a $200 item will receive a $30 credit toward future purchases. This straightforward calculation ensures transparency in retail transactions and helps manage customer expectations clearly.
